What is an slp contract?

An SLP Contract job is a temporary position where a Speech-Language Pathologist (SLP) is hired for a set period, typically through a staffing agency or directly by a school, hospital, or healthcare facility. These contracts can range from a few months to a full school year and may offer flexibility in location and schedule. SLPs in contract roles assess, diagnose, and treat communication and swallowing disorders in various settings. Benefits often include competitive pay, travel opportunities, and potential contract renewal.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the slp contract position?

To thrive as an SLP Contract, you typically need a master's degree in Speech-Language Pathology, state licensure, and often a Certificate of Clinical Competence (CCC-SLP). Familiarity with assessment tools, therapy software, and electronic medical record (EMR) systems is important for documentation and service delivery. Outstanding interpersonal skills, adaptability, and effective communication make a significant difference in client engagement and multidisciplinary collaboration. These skills and qualifications are crucial for delivering tailored therapy, ensuring compliance, and facilitating positive outcomes for clients.

What does a typical workweek look like for an slp contract professional?

A typical workweek for an SLP Contract professional involves assessing and treating clients with speech, language, or swallowing disorders, often in schools, clinics, or via teletherapy platforms. You will coordinate with teachers, parents, and other healthcare professionals to develop and implement individualized treatment plans while maintaining accurate documentation of progress. Many contract SLPs manage their own caseloads and schedules, which offers flexibility but also requires strong organizational skills to meet various service requirements. Depending on the setting, your weekly responsibilities may include conducting group or individual therapy sessions, participating in IEP meetings, and attending multidisciplinary team discussions. The role combines direct client interaction with collaboration and administrative tasks to support the communication needs of those you serve.

We are looking for a talented In-person Speech Language Pathologist (SLP) or SLPA or SLP-CF to join our team for the school year.

Hourly Rate Range: $40.00 - $65.00 per hour

Responsibilities would include:

  • Conduct comprehensive assessments to evaluate students' speech, language, and communication needs.
  • Develop and implement Individualized Education Programs (IEPs) tailored to each student's requirements.
  • Provide direct therapy services in individual, small group, and classroom settings.
  • Address challenges related to articulation, fluency, voice, language comprehension and expression, and social communication.
  • Collaborate with teachers, parents, and multidisciplinary teams to support student development.
  • Maintain accurate records of assessments, therapy sessions, and student progress in compliance with Illinois State Board of Education (ISBE) and IDEA guidelines.
  • Participate in IEP meetings, student evaluations, and provide consultation as needed.
  • Educate and support staff and parents on strategies to enhance communication skills.

Required Qualifications:

  • Master's or Doctoral degree in Speech-Language Pathology from an accredited program.
  • Illinois Department of Financial and Professional Regulation (IDFPR) License.
  • Illinois State Board of Education (ISBE) Professional Educator License (PEL) with a Speech-Language Pathologist Endorsement.
  • Certificate of Clinical Competence (CCC-SLP) from ASHA preferred.
  • Fingerprint Clearance & Background Check required.
